CONTROL OF THE OPERATING CONDITIONS OF A MARINE GAS-TURBINE INSTALLATION ACCORDING TO THE TEMPERATURE OF THE EXTERNAL AIR
Control of the power of a gas-turbine installation under rated conditions by changing the air temperature at the input to the second compressor is examined. The work was done to increase the stability of the power characteristic of the installation. A three-shaft installation is used. It is found that the use of an air-temperature regulator at the input to the second compressor makes it possible to create installations whose free power is preserved regardless of the temperature of the external air and to increase efficiency when the ship is in cold regions.
